+John James McCartney It is unfortunate that The Shadows records weren't given proper promotion in the US; Apache was released on Atlantic Records, and Jorgen Ingman's version was released on ATCO, a subsidiary of Atlantic. Ingman's version was promoted and soared in the charts. The Ventures also released their version of Apache on an album; "The Ventures play Telestar." I've not been to a Ventures concert that Apache was not played. I went to the Shadows Final Tour show at the Apollo in Hammersmith, London in June 2004. Only time I've been to a Shadows concert, I enjoyed that.

@@roycentanni6985 sorry Roy I love the V’s but that ain’t true re: the Beatles. But when it came to selling guitars the ventures and Mosrite had a deal with Sears in the mid 60s when it was one of the biggest retailers in the country. They also created such a guitar boom in Japan that businesses that had nothing to do with guitars started making them.
